Three product leaders took three different routes through the AI shift. Dana Ingraham went to an AI startup and started sending clickable prototypes instead of resumes. Briana Ings stayed in big tech and translated her data science background into AI evals. Pei-Chin Wang left to found a company where everyone codes.
Drawn from The Skip. What changed about the PM job, why the barrier to building with AI is emotional rather than technical, and how each of them held hard boundaries while working at the bleeding edge.
